Slab vs Outline: What are the differences?
Developers describe Slab as "The knowledge base that democratizes knowledge". It is the knowledge base entirely focused on just being the very best knowledge base for your entire team. Choose the best tools for the rest of your productivity stack and Slab will integrate with them, including Slack, Asana, GitHub, and dozens more. On the other hand, Outline is detailed as "Open source knowledge base and wiki for your team". It is the fastest wiki and knowledge base for growing teams. Beautiful, feature rich, markdown compatible and open source. Team wiki, documentation, meeting notes, playbooks, onboarding, work logs, brainstorming, & more.
Slab can be classified as a tool in the "CRM" category, while Outline is grouped under "Knowledge Management".
Some of the features offered by Slab are:
- Create content that looks good by default
- Make it easy for teammates to browse and discover
- Unified Search
On the other hand, Outline provides the following key features:
- Blazing Fast
- Markdown Support
- Get Slack notifications about changes and search Outline directly within Slack
Outline is an open source tool with 9.94K GitHub stars and 678 GitHub forks. Here's a link to Outline's open source repository on GitHub.
